How to Sell Designer Handbags to Sell Quickly and For the Best PriceDesigner bags like the Hermes Birkin have a great price for resales. They are sought-after for their style, craftsmanship and brand reputation.
Direct sale or consignment are the two options for selling designer handbags online. Direct sale allows sellers to keep a higher percentage of the price they sell.
Selling to a consignment shop reduces the amount of work and risk of verifying authenticity, determining the price and dealing with potential buyers.

When choosing an online store there are a few things to take into consideration:
The audience reach is: How many potential customers will be able to browse and buy your bags? Credibility and trustworthiness: Does your platform enjoy a good reputation with its customers? Transaction security is a concern: Does the website provide safe and secure payment options?
Seller fees: Be aware that some sites will charge a flat fee when you post your items for sale, while others will charge part of the final sale. If profit maximization is a priority for you it's a good idea to select an online store that has low fees for sellers.

Before listing your bag for sale, examine the bag carefully and note any scratches or scuffs. Also, note if there are any creases, tarnishings or other indications. These information will allow buyers to assess whether the bag is worth the price. You should also save any accessories that came with your bag such as the dust bag and authenticity cards. These items will add to the value of your bag, and provide buyers the confidence that they're purchasing a genuine item.

eBay is a great choice to sell a designer bag online. The site has a vast market and easy listing and delivery options. It also lets sellers set prices and pay a small commission for selling. List your designer bag in a way that shows its value. For example, "luxury preowned." Include plenty of pictures along with a detailed description about the condition of the bag.
Another option is Rebag an online resale site that buys and sells luxury bags. You can bring your bag to an Rebag store and receive an estimate within one hour. They also provide a free shipping label that you can use to ship the bag back to them. The website and app let you sell your bag without having to worry about scams or fraudsters.
